Abstract
There is provided a vehicle motion control device that defines a pre-curve entry deceleration amount taking the deceleration amount that occurs while traveling a curve into consideration. A vehicle motion control device 6 comprises: a lateral motion-coordinated acceleration/deceleration calculation means 11 that calculates lateral motion-coordinated acceleration/deceleration Gx_dGy, which is the longitudinal acceleration/deceleration of a vehicle 0 that is coordinated with lateral motion, in accordance with lateral jerk Gy_max that acts on the vehicle 0 at curve entry; and a vehicle speed control device 12, which calculates pre-curve entry deceleration Gx_preC that is to be generated with respect to the vehicle 0 before entering the curve, taking lateral motion-coordinated acceleration/deceleration Gx_dGy calculated by the lateral motion-coordinated acceleration/deceleration calculation device 11 into consideration. Thus, over-deceleration of pre-curve entry deceleration Gx_preC may be prevented, and the connection between pre-curve entry deceleration Gx_preC and lateral motion-coordinated acceleration/deceleration Gx_dGy made smooth, thereby mitigating the sense of unnaturalness experienced by the driver.
